I would also have to add that the Integra and Honda models while having the horsepower figures deliver their power in quite a different manner. A turbocharger typically is less linear in its power delivery down low in the torque band and when the turbo spools up you can have some issues with making positive contact with the pavement. Honda and Acura models typically are lower in their torque delivery and make most of their power up high where most people don't normally range on the street.
